On May 7, Beijing time, the 2024 World Snooker Championship came to an end in the early morning, and the post-90s generation reached the top and announced the end of the 2023/2024 season.

Kyren Wilson 18-14 Jack Jones, the "strongest post-90s" returns! This is his sixth career ranking championship and his first world championship. After all, Luca, the first post-90s world champion in history, has only 4 ranking championships in his career, and the World Championships result is 1 championship and 6 rounds, while Karen has reached the World Championship finals twice, ranking 11th in history with one championship and one runner-up, following Trump with one championship and two runners-up, before the first champion Neil Robertson, Bingham, Luka, two Asian winners Matthew Stevens, Carter and others.

It was also his first title of the season, having last won the 2022 European Masters, becoming the 12th winner of the season (in chronological order):

Shaun Murphy (2023 Champions League Ranking Tournament Version), lost to Maguire 9-13 in this World Championship, stopped in the second round, and rose one place to No. 7 compared to the ranking before the start of the World Championships.

Barry Hawkins (2023 European Masters), 8-10 Ryan Day, suffered a first-round tour, and the ranking remains unchanged at 15th.

Ronnie O'Sullivan (2023 Shanghai Masters, British Championships, 2024 Masters, World Grand Prix and Riyadh Carnival Season Masters), including two championships in the ranking tournament, but unfortunately the World Championships 10-13 Bingham, missed the eighth set of Grand Slams, dropped four places to No. 5, and his career dominance time is temporarily fixed at 386 weeks, which is still a lot of distance from the 471 weeks of the all-time No. 1 Hendry.

Mark Williams (2023 British Open, Tour Championship), 9-10 Si Jiahui at Uncle Ma, suffered a round trip. But he is the only player this season to beat O'Sullivan in the final, and he is the world No. 1, No. 2 and No. 3 in the world. The ranking dropped three places to No. 9.

Judd Trump (2023 English Open, Wuhan Open, Northern Ireland Open, 2024 German Open and World Open), five-time champion of the ranking tournament, 9-13 Jack Jones in this stop, stopped in the quarterfinals, and the ranking remains unchanged or second.

Zhang Anda (2023 National Championships), 4-10 Jack Jones in this station, suffered a round of tours, and dropped one place to 12th. However, this season, Zhang Anda continued to break through career highs, breaking the semi-finals, finals, and championships in the ranking competition, ranking fourth in the season with one championship and two runners-up, and the opponents in the final were Trump and Allen, and the silver content was not low.

Mark Allen (2023 Champion of Champions, Single Game Limited-Time Tournament and 2024 Players Championship), 12-13 Higgins in this station, stopped in the second round, rose two places to No. 1, and reached the top for the first time in his career! Higgins said after the game that he cried for 20 seconds in the lounge, and it was indeed not easy to win, and the tiebreaker was 0-62 behind! Although Karen was 8-13 in the quarterfinals, winning the duel with Allen made him thrillingly hold the top16 position, and his ranking dropped three places to No. 16.

G-Wilson (2023 Scottish Open & 2024 Welsh Open), 5-10 Bingham, suffered a first-round tour and dropped one place to 11th.

Mark Selby (2024 Snooker Champions League Invitational Edition), 6-10 Crucible newcomer O'Connor, dropped one place to No. 6. The latter was 6-13 Karen, stopping in the second round and moving up one spot to No. 29.

Luca (Mixed Doubles World Invitational Tournament), the defending champion was beaten with a wave of four consecutive whips under a 9-6 lead, 9-10 Gilbert, suffered a round, becoming the seventh defending champion of the World Championships in history to make a round. The ranking remains unchanged at No. 4.

Kyren Wilson (World Championships), the ranking soared 9 places to third!

One of the strongest dark horses in history, Jack: Jones created the biggest upset in the 1/4 finals of the World Championships, 13-9 world second! became the second newcomer in history after Matthew Stevens to advance to the quarterfinals of Crucible for two consecutive years, this station he single-handedly picked off half of the Chinese snooker army, since the trial round 10-4 Zhou Yuelong, Zhang Anda, Si Jiahui also lost to him, and the Chinese snooker army only 8 people entered the top 48, 5 people entered the main competition.

Jack Jones, who was born in 94, did not dare to say that he was the "third person born in the 90s", but the third person born in the 90s at the World Championships deserved his name, soaring 30 places in the rankings, and ranked 16th for the first time in his career, to 14th.

Ding Junhui 9-10 Jack Lisowski, suffered a round trip to Crucible for four consecutive years, and his ranking dropped one place to No. 8!

Si Jiahui was newly promoted to the "Third Brother of China", and his ranking rose 3 places to 20th.
